As you've heard, the government approved 00:08:32.462 --> 00:08:36.662 amendments to the Spatial Planning Act 00:08:36.779 --> 00:08:39.965 that will shorten procedures for the preparation 00:08:40.086 --> 00:08:43.480 and approval of spatial plans. 00:08:43.909 --> 00:08:46.325 With the amendment to the Building Act 00:08:46.446 --> 00:08:50.858 at the previous government meeting, we expedited the preparation 00:08:50.979 --> 00:08:54.661 of documentation and the issuance of building permits. 00:08:54.782 --> 00:08:57.911 The elements introduced by today's amendment 00:08:58.032 --> 00:09:02.645 primarily consist of changes to municipal spatial plans 00:09:02.768 --> 00:09:06.173 and state spatial plans, which can now be prepared 00:09:06.294 --> 00:09:08.696 and approved in a year or two. 00:09:08.836 --> 00:09:12.196 The legislation hasn't allowed that until now. 00:09:12.318 --> 00:09:17.106 In practice, these procedures lasted several years, sometimes five, 00:09:17.227 --> 00:09:19.999 and we have a case where the spatial plan 00:09:20.120 --> 00:09:22.541 wasn't approved for 20 years. 00:09:22.662 --> 00:09:25.730 Secondly, we are introducing a new category, 00:09:25.841 --> 00:09:29.091 known as the Minor Change, which covers targeted 00:09:29.212 --> 00:09:31.557 changes to municipal spatial plans. 00:09:31.650 --> 00:09:35.797 This covers cases where existing business activity or property 00:09:35.918 --> 00:09:38.351 is expanded up to 5000 square meters, 00:09:38.472 --> 00:09:41.156 when the size of the existing settlement 00:09:41.277 --> 00:09:45.377 doesn't increase by more than 30%. Minor changes don't require 00:09:45.498 --> 00:09:50.394 complete expert studies, but can instead focus 00:09:50.550 --> 00:09:54.873 on a few specific buildings or plans, 00:09:54.994 --> 00:09:58.074 which makes the entire process faster. 00:09:58.197 --> 00:10:02.418 The law enables such targeted measures to be approved 00:10:02.539 --> 00:10:05.102 within half a year to a year. 00:10:05.280 --> 00:10:08.864 This is a substantial innovation or benefit. 00:10:09.318 --> 00:10:12.985 The third thing that is important is that now 00:10:13.286 --> 00:10:17.838 the issuance of opinions by the spatial planning authorities 00:10:17.921 --> 00:10:19.754 is limited to 30 days. 00:10:20.571 --> 00:10:24.119 The spatial planning authorities may refuse to prepare an opinion. 00:10:24.202 --> 00:10:26.706 By doing so, they agree to the planned solution 00:10:26.789 --> 00:10:29.040 without the elaboration of a spatial plan. 00:10:29.123 --> 00:10:32.706 Why is this essential? If it doesn't affect the water or something else, 00:10:32.789 --> 00:10:35.602 they don't need to write long opinions, 00:10:35.685 --> 00:10:39.140 we've relieved the burden of administration. 00:10:39.223 --> 00:10:41.499 They simply agree or don't write anything, 00:10:41.582 --> 00:10:44.300 which counts as a positive opinion. 00:10:44.383 --> 00:10:46.133 That is a big change, 00:10:46.379 --> 00:10:50.592 because you know that in practice not issuing an opinion or consent 00:10:50.675 --> 00:10:52.480 used to mean a negative decision 00:10:52.563 --> 00:10:57.116 or a long wait to obtain such an opinion. 00:10:58.686 --> 00:11:02.368 We have stipulated that spatial planning authorities 00:11:02.451 --> 00:11:04.052 must make the information 00:11:04.135 --> 00:11:06.630 on which they base their opinions and conditions 00:11:06.713 --> 00:11:09.936 publicly available in advance in the spatial information system. 00:11:10.019 --> 00:11:11.988 This is to ensure 00:11:12.072 --> 00:11:18.744 that everyone is treated transparently, on equal terms. 00:11:20.138 --> 00:11:23.601 Digitisation makes this possible. We have quite a few programmes 00:11:23.684 --> 00:11:26.107 to improve the spatial planning IT system, 00:11:26.190 --> 00:11:29.190 both at national and municipal level. 00:11:29.337 --> 00:11:33.487 Another innovation, based on the practice 00:11:33.571 --> 00:11:37.738 that we have developed in the flood rehabilitation. 00:11:37.940 --> 00:11:40.653 We're introducing the simultaneous location consideration 00:11:40.736 --> 00:11:43.281 of the targeted changes to spatial plans 00:11:43.364 --> 00:11:45.501 and the construction documentation. 00:11:45.584 --> 00:11:51.615 So that we can obtain an opinion on one as well as the other act. 00:11:51.862 --> 00:11:56.164 The spatial plan as well as the construction documentation. 00:11:56.247 --> 00:11:58.664 This has proved to be useful. 00:11:59.571 --> 00:12:02.769 Perhaps in future it will be necessary to do more 00:12:02.852 --> 00:12:07.799 without repeating individual procedures one after the other. 00:12:09.402 --> 00:12:12.854 The task of coordinating and harmonising opinions 00:12:12.937 --> 00:12:17.686 in the preparation of national and municipal spatial plans 00:12:17.769 --> 00:12:19.664 is being returned to me 00:12:19.747 --> 00:12:23.748 and to the responsible persons in other ministries. 00:12:23.831 --> 00:12:29.056 The municipalities have been at the mercy 00:12:29.140 --> 00:12:32.409 of individual consenting authorities 00:12:32.727 --> 00:12:35.915 and have waited for a long time. 00:12:35.999 --> 00:12:38.859 We're setting up an inter-ministerial commission 00:12:38.942 --> 00:12:41.534 headed by the Minister of Spatial Planning. 00:12:41.617 --> 00:12:46.142 We will help municipalities and others to quickly harmonise 00:12:46.225 --> 00:12:49.090 the individual opinions and other things 00:12:49.173 --> 00:12:53.027 that are done in such a procedure. 00:12:53.952 --> 00:12:57.628 In a way, we have also eliminated the duplication of the procedure 00:12:57.711 --> 00:13:02.403 for the preparation of municipal or national spatial plans 00:13:02.486 --> 00:13:05.247 and the comprehensive environmental impact assessment. 00:13:05.330 --> 00:13:08.087 We have unified the departments involved, 00:13:08.170 --> 00:13:11.137 the ministries responsible for each area. 00:13:11.220 --> 00:13:16.197 Opinions will be obtained by one ministry, in this case ours. 00:13:16.280 --> 00:13:20.171 Once these opinions are obtained 00:13:20.345 --> 00:13:23.324 we will finalise spatial planning procedures. 00:13:23.407 --> 00:13:27.180 The Ministry of the Environment, Climate and Energy 00:13:27.263 --> 00:13:30.462 will deal with the environmental impact assessment. 00:13:30.545 --> 00:13:33.584 The competences remain exactly the same, 00:13:33.667 --> 00:13:37.429 we're simply combining the same opinions 00:13:37.513 --> 00:13:41.430 by using them for two purposes at the same time. 00:13:42.054 --> 00:13:44.205 We have also made some new provisions 00:13:44.288 --> 00:13:47.124 in relation to the activation of building land. 00:13:47.207 --> 00:13:52.823 Nowadays, the problem is that there is a lot of building land, 00:13:52.907 --> 00:13:57.448 which has been dead capital for years and years. 00:13:57.829 --> 00:14:03.051 This is why the act makes it possible 00:14:03.135 --> 00:14:06.068 for the municipalities and for others 00:14:06.151 --> 00:14:08.881 to activate these lands and build on them. 00:14:08.964 --> 00:14:10.565 What does this mean? 00:14:10.648 --> 00:14:13.802 We have made it possible again, as it used to be, 00:14:13.885 --> 00:14:15.857 that the adoption 00:14:15.941 --> 00:14:20.077 of the municipality's detailed spatial plan be accompanied by 00:14:20.160 --> 00:14:23.980 the infrastructure delivery plan. They can be adopted at the same time. 00:14:24.063 --> 00:14:26.720 The municipality must work with investors to ensure 00:14:26.803 --> 00:14:30.111 that the building land is equipped as soon as possible, 00:14:30.194 --> 00:14:35.027 and no later than ten years after the adoption of the programme. 00:14:35.110 --> 00:14:40.844 So that investors know what they're in for. 00:14:41.750 --> 00:14:43.351 A statutory exemption 00:14:43.434 --> 00:14:46.357 from the payment of the municipal contribution is also provided for. 00:14:46.440 --> 00:14:50.645 As is the obligation to calculate the municipal contribution 00:14:50.728 --> 00:14:53.728 before the building permit is issued. 00:14:53.903 --> 00:14:56.838 Payments may also be contractual over a longer period. 00:14:56.921 --> 00:14:59.459 The municipality may exempt 00:14:59.685 --> 00:15:02.504 the payment of the municipal contribution 00:15:02.587 --> 00:15:07.594 especially in cases where only the gross floor area is increased 00:15:07.677 --> 00:15:11.543 due to elevators, energy or structural renovation, 00:15:11.627 --> 00:15:15.047 because the net programme remains the same. 00:15:15.130 --> 00:15:16.731 The municipality can exempt 00:15:16.814 --> 00:15:19.963 the payment of the municipal contribution 00:15:20.046 --> 00:15:23.691 for new constructions for public rental housing, 00:15:23.774 --> 00:15:29.118 in short, to support the public housing construction programme. 00:15:29.930 --> 00:15:33.916 The deadline for the assessment of the municipal contribution 00:15:33.999 --> 00:15:38.808 is 30 days, just as any appeals at the second instance 00:15:38.892 --> 00:15:42.309 are required to be settled within 30 days. 00:15:43.008 --> 00:15:49.189 We have established rules to facilitate the assessment 00:15:49.273 --> 00:15:52.200 of the advance payment of the municipal contribution 00:15:52.283 --> 00:15:55.240 as one of the municipal financial resources. 00:15:55.323 --> 00:15:59.992 The municipality must levy a tax on unused building land. 00:16:00.429 --> 00:16:03.868 We have set a deadline of 2027 at the latest. 00:16:03.951 --> 00:16:08.410 This used to be optional, but is now mandatory 00:16:08.494 --> 00:16:12.646 in order to speed up the preparation of building land 00:16:12.729 --> 00:16:16.270 and to remove the blockage in the country. 00:16:16.354 --> 00:16:19.616 Many constructions are taking so long 00:16:19.700 --> 00:16:24.228 because of the lengthy process of adopting the plans 00:16:24.312 --> 00:16:26.562 or preparing building land. 00:16:27.313 --> 00:16:32.730 The second important topic was the so-called admission regulation. 00:16:33.127 --> 00:16:35.334 The admission regulation 00:16:35.716 --> 00:16:41.950 as part of the Waters Act 00:16:42.606 --> 00:16:49.391 eliminates the unequal treatment between water rights holders. 00:16:49.938 --> 00:16:53.180 The regulation will not affect the price of drinking water. 00:16:53.263 --> 00:16:54.864 A water right can be granted 00:16:54.947 --> 00:16:58.348 by a concession agreement or a water licence. 00:16:58.431 --> 00:17:00.798 The Waters Act, adopted in 2002, 00:17:00.881 --> 00:17:04.391 has already stipulated that for each use of water 00:17:04.474 --> 00:17:07.745 a payment for water rights or water reimbursement is payable. 00:17:07.828 --> 00:17:12.076 This provision has only been enforced for the water right holders, 00:17:12.159 --> 00:17:16.061 who had concession agreements for the use of water. 00:17:16.144 --> 00:17:20.200 Now it applies to all water right holders. 00:17:21.234 --> 00:17:27.931 This regulation will now eliminate the inequality between them. 00:17:28.638 --> 00:17:32.932 The concession holders have been paying, 00:17:33.016 --> 00:17:37.516 but those with the permit for the use of water haven't. 00:17:37.738 --> 00:17:40.520 This was pointed out by the Court of Auditors, 00:17:40.603 --> 00:17:43.117 the Commission for the Prevention of Corruption, 00:17:43.200 --> 00:17:47.332 which specifically warned that we were putting citizens and businesses 00:17:47.415 --> 00:17:49.112 on an unequal footing, 00:17:49.195 --> 00:17:51.663 and last but not least the European Commission, 00:17:51.746 --> 00:17:56.101 which is also setting one of the key milestones 00:17:56.580 --> 00:18:02.408 in terms of regulating this source of funds 00:18:02.492 --> 00:18:08.671 and treating all entities that use water for their activities equally. 00:18:09.214 --> 00:18:11.624 We have now reached this milestone. 00:18:11.707 --> 00:18:17.264 Slovenia will therefore continue to benefit from cohesion funding. 00:18:18.305 --> 00:18:22.671 Where do these funds from the Waters Act go? 00:18:22.999 --> 00:18:27.615 All funds from water use, already existing concessions, 00:18:27.699 --> 00:18:29.700 admission and water reimbursements, 00:18:29.783 --> 00:18:33.087 are intended to protect water resources, 00:18:33.802 --> 00:18:37.302 for water regulation to reduce flood risks, 00:18:37.745 --> 00:18:39.896 improve drinking water supply, 00:18:39.979 --> 00:18:42.896 and discharge and treat waste water, 00:18:43.517 --> 00:18:48.184 while promoting responsible and sustainable use of water. 00:18:48.411 --> 00:18:52.734 The supply of drinking water to the population remains unchanged. 00:18:52.817 --> 00:18:59.108 We also have this provision in Article 70 of the Constitution, 00:18:59.192 --> 00:19:03.351 which puts the right to drinking water first 00:19:03.435 --> 00:19:05.801 as a constitutional right. 00:19:06.929 --> 00:19:08.998 To sum it all up, 00:19:09.745 --> 00:19:15.120 after many years we have eliminated inequality in payment, 00:19:15.261 --> 00:19:17.917 and regulated it in such a way 00:19:18.001 --> 00:19:22.786 so that we can manage the Water Fund more effectively, 00:19:22.870 --> 00:19:26.278 whether for the protection of drinking water 00:19:26.361 --> 00:19:29.721 or for the elimination of flood and other hazards. 00:19:29.804 --> 00:19:33.995 Thank you very much, Minister.
